Sooo I got the TB rebuild done, unplugged the battery while I put it on to reset the ECM, plugged the battery back in after I was done and did a IAC relearn before cranking it. Immediately obvious that the passenger side injector was leaking, so I cut it off and redid all the o-rings in the pod. Cranked it back up, no leaks. But it runs like ****. It stalled the first time I put it in drive. However, after re-cranking it it did start to run better and it didn't stall the next time I put it in drive. Its been suggested that I run it 30 miles or so after a re-learn for it to get perfect, so we'll see. Battery unhooked for a bit to clear computer, hooked battery back up. Jumped top right two terminals on OBD1 port, turned key forward, waited 30 seconds or so, turned key off, removed jumper, cranked truck.

Two things in that procedure can tell you you did it right: 1) the SES light flashing once, pausing, then twice for a code 12, which is normal operation, and 2) you can feel the valve body of the IAC pulsing as the motor repeatedly draws back.

Gotcha, the IAC will reset/learn it self within 100 miles of driving as well. If its not doing any better by that point, you have a different problem.

Did you clean all the ports in the side of the TB well? the egr one gets pretty dirty and clogs the passage way..
